Christie: Trump’s Potential ‘Vendetta Tour’ in Second Term is ‘Scary’

**Former New Jersey Governor Chris Christie (R) expressed his concerns about President Trump’s potential ‘vendetta tour’ if he wins a second term in the White House, describing it as a ‘scary thing’ for the United States. Christie, who supported Trump in his 2016 presidential run but later ran against him in the 2024 Republican presidential primary, outlined his primary fear as Trump’s potential pursuit of political retribution against his perceived enemies, without any checks and balances to contain his actions.

In an interview, Christie stated, ‘There’ll be no one around to put guardrails up, and he will be on the vendetta tour against all enemies that he perceives. And that’s a scary thing for the country.’ Despite these concerns, Christie confirmed that he would not be voting for President Biden in November.

Christie expressed his disapproval of Biden, stating, ‘I don’t think so. No, President Biden, in my view, is past the sell-by date. Seriously, look at him. If the American people are stupid enough to nominate these two guys, doesn’t mean I have to be stupid, too.’ He added that Biden had not reached out to him for support.

Christie had previously considered a third-party run with No Labels, a centrist ballot-access organization, but ultimately decided against it due to a lack of a viable path forward. ‘Nobody that we put up, including me, got higher than 17 percent. So what happens is [voters] love the idea of someone other than Trump or Biden, but then … once you [put forward an alternative], they don’t want to hear it,’ Christie told The Post. ‘We looked at it pretty closely. There was no path to winning.’
